How they compare
Uruguay currently reports 73.0% against 71.7% in Guyana, a difference of 1.3%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 11 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Guyana ahead.
Guyana ranks 6th and Uruguay ranks 5th of 144 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Guyana averaged higher in 5 and Uruguay in 1.
